Should you have any queries, please contact Jobfit Coorparoo on (07) 3847 9844 or email coorparoo@jobfit.com.au Jobfit open for business in Port Lincoln Jobfit is excited to announce the opening of a new centre in Port Lincoln, South Australia. Increasing demand for occupational healthcare services in the Eyre Peninsula, including fast turnaround of pre-employment medical appointments and results, has seen Jobfit regularly deploy staff from Adelaide to the region for onsite assessments. Jobfit’s National General Manager, Steven Harvey, says the decision to open a centre in Port Lincoln was an easy one. “Jobfit has a large number of clients in the mining and agricultural sectors that source candidates in this region, and therefore we expect demand for our services will continue”, Mr Harvey said. "Our new centre in Port Lincoln will offer pre-employment and periodic medical assessments, functional capacity evaluations, drug and alcohol screening, as well as vocational rehabilitation services ", he said. Mr Harvey believes that the new Port Lincoln centre will not only provide improved services for existing clients, business and industry in the local area can benefit from Jobfit’s wide range of occupational healthcare services. “Jobfit is delighted to have secured local staff including an experienced vocational rehabilitation coordinator who can assist employers with return to work planning for their injured workers”, said Mr Harvey. The new centre is located in the Civic Centre, Suite 13, 60 Tasman Terrace. Further information regarding our vocational rehabilitation services is available via email info@jobfit.com.au, or by calling 1800 994 808. 1 July 2011 Jobfit extends Queensland operations with acquisition of QVHS Jobfit Health Group has extended its network of occupational healthcare centres in Queensland by acquiring the business operations of Brisbane-based Queensland Vocational Health Services (QVHS). QVHS provides a comprehensive range of occupational medical services including pre-employment and pre-placement assessments, injury management, rehabilitation programs, and health and risk assessments. The business will be rebranded to Jobfit over the coming months. Jobfit’s National General Manager, Mr Steven Harvey, said the acquisition will support the increasing demand on occupational healthcare services in the Queensland region, particularly Queensland Coal Board medical assessments and injury management services. "The acquisition of QVHS will provide us with additional medical resources and facilities in Queensland and offers synergies with our existing operations in West End and Gladstone", said Mr Harvey. The QVHS centre is located at 295 Chatsworth Road, Coorparoo. 14 September 2010 Jobfit opens new Mount Gambier centre One of Australia’s leading occupational healthcare providers, Jobfit Health Group, will further expand its South Australian operations with the launch of a Mount Gambier centre on 23 September. After serving employers in the South-East from its Adelaide centre over a number of years, Jobfit will open a centre on Helen Street with its allied health partner, Northcare Physiotherapy. The opening comes at a time of growth for Jobfit, which has seen a number of new centres open across Australia in the past twelve months to cater for the increased demand in pre-employment medical assessments. Jobfit’s National General Manager, Steve Harvey, said “We are excited to open a centre in Mount Gambier which will extend our capacity to provide pre-employment medical services in the South-East”. “There is increasing demand for our services as a result of major resource and construction projects across Australia, also employers are recognising the importance of identifying any potential risks to the health and safety of employees”, Mr Harvey said. Mr Harvey said the new Mount Gambier centre will provide convenience for both employers and candidates located in the South-East, and employers looking to recruit from the region. 13 April 2010 Jobfit broadens healthcare services with acquisition of Northcare Jobfit Health Group (Jobfit) today announced that it has broadened its suite of healthcare services by acquiring the business operations of the Adelaide-based allied health business, Northcare Physiotherapy (Northcare). Northcare is a physiotherapy, sports injuries and rehabilitation business with approximately 80 staff located in 15 centres across South Australia and Sydney. Jobfit’s National General Manager, Steven Harvey, said the acquisition was part of a strategy to expand and diversify Jobfit’s comprehensive range of medical services. “Personal allied health services are a natural extension of our existing corporate healthcare operations and the acquisition of Northcare adds an important element to our overall strategy of diversification and expansion”. Northcare will retain all of its current locations, including its original flagship centre at Park Terrace, Salisbury. All employees of Northcare have accepted employment with Jobfit, taking its total workforce to 165 staff Australia-wide. “We acknowledge Northcare’s 15 year history and brand recognition, particularly in Adelaide’s northern suburbs. Northcare’s patients will continue to receive professional healthcare services from the dedicated staff they know and trust” said Mr Harvey.
